Test & Characterisation Engineer

Suffolk, UK

Onsite working required

Key Responsibilities
  • Design, build, and execute complex optical and electrical test setups, including automated measurement systems.
  • Develop effective Design of Experiments (DoE) methodologies and perform advanced measurements to support product development.
  • Create and implement modular characterisation protocols and test methods.
